Albumism’s 50 Best Albums of 2018 | #14: Interpol’s ‘Marauder’

November 30, 2018 Albumism Staff

EXPLORE the full album index here

#14
Interpol
| Marauder
Matador

According to Rayna Khaitan: “From its celestial NYC-dwelling dreaminess to the exemplary way the band’s individual talents coalesce into a sonic tour de force to its eddying stream of consciousness conclusion, Marauder is a captivating force that demonstrates the trio are in no way lacking—a claim some have made since the band’s bassist left in 2010, after the making of their fourth album.”
